Is fungus considered as a decomposer?

<span>Fungi is a decomposer. They make enzymes that decompose the decaying matter while feasting on the nutrients of that substance. This is why that most fungi are useful because without them, the biomass would be crowded with dead matter. Other decomposers include bacteria and actinomycetes. hope it helps ;)

What effect does an unbalanced for have on an object
Mars2501 [29]
C. An unbalanced force means there will be a net force in a certain direction. Any net force will cause an object to accelerate in the direction of the net force.
